If you're eligible for funded hours, can you use them in your work place if you work as a childminder/in a nursery? Or would it need to be in a different location or on a day you aren't working? Any advice appreciated x

If you’re a childminder no as you’d be paying to look after your own children.
in a nursery yes as you wouldn’t be in the same room as your child and you are paying the setting not the individual

As @Danikm151 said if you’re a childminder your child can attend nursery/pre school using the funding but a childminder cannot claim the funded hours for their own child.
